The New England Province of the Society of Jesus Archives collections include administrative records and publications of the Province, Jamaica and Iraq foreign mission records, as well as personal papers and a collection of books authored by members of the former New England Province. There is also a large audiovisual collection of tapes, films, slides and photographs.

This digitized collection features several histories of the New England Jesuit Province and the yearbooks of two schools, Baghdad College and Al-Hikma University, administered by the Jesuits of the New England Province in Baghdad, Iraq. It also includes a history of these schools and the Jesuits in Baghdad, Jesuits by the Tigris, by Fr. Joseph MacDonnell, S.J.

In December 2014, The New England Province and the New York Province united to become the USA Northeast Province. In March 2016, the physical collections were moved from New England and are currently hosted by the Jesuit Archives: Central United States in St. Louis, Missouri.
